Problem:
Users with large photo and video libraries (5000+ files per folder) experience severe performance issues and OutOfMemoryError (OOM) crashes when opening folders. The application receives a massive XML file from the server and attempts to parse it entirely in memory, causing:
Solution:
Rewrote the parsing block from the old ownCloud approach to a new streaming parser implementation. Additionally implemented batch processing for folders. This eliminates OOM errors and significantly improves performance and stability, even with 20,000+ photos and videos in a single folder.
